What does a CNC supervisor do?

A CNC Supervisor oversees the daily operations of CNC machining teams, ensuring production runs efficiently and meets quality standards. They are responsible for managing machinists, troubleshooting equipment issues, optimizing workflows, and maintaining adherence to safety and production guidelines. Additionally, they coordinate with engineers and production planners to meet deadlines and improve manufacturing processes. Strong leadership, technical knowledge, and problem-solving skills are essential for success in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a CNC supervisor?

To thrive as a CNC Supervisor, you need a solid understanding of CNC machining processes, production management, and quality control, usually supported by relevant technical training or a degree in manufacturing technology. Familiarity with CNC programming software (such as Mastercam or Siemens), ERP systems, and safety regulations is highly desirable, as are certifications like NIMS or equivalent.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ills set exceptional supervisors apart in overseeing teams and optimizing workflows. These skills are crucial for ensuring production efficiency, maintaining safety standards, and fostering a collaborative, productive work environment.

What is a CNC supervisor?

A CNC supervisor oversees the operation of computer numerical control (CNC) machines in manufacturing settings. They coordinate production schedules, ensure quality standards, and supervise machine operators, often requiring knowledge of CNC programming and safety protocols.

WHAT WE'RE LOOKING FOR IN A CNC OPERATIONS SUPERVISOR

Multi-axis machining, CAD/CAM programming, Lean/5S knowledge, and experience training teams are preferred. Does that sound like you? If so, and you meet the following criteria, we want you as our CNC Operations Supervisor!

  • 5+ years of CNC machining experience with strong G-code knowledge
  • Leadership experience in manufacturing
  • Ability to read blueprints, GD&T, and technical drawings
  • Strong problem-solving skills for machining, tooling, and programming issues
  • Proficiency with measurement tools such as micrometers, calipers, height gauges, and CMMs
  • Familiarity with CNC controls such as Haas, Fanuc, Mazak, Okuma, or similar
  • Basic computer skills for documentation and ERP systems
  • Ability to lift 40–50 lbs and stand for extended periods

DAY-TO-DAY

In this role, you'll oversee daily CNC operations, assign tasks, and ensure workflow efficiency. You'll set up, program, and operate CNC machines, troubleshoot issues, and maintain quality standards. You'll mentor operators, collaborate with engineering, and keep production running smoothly while enforcing safety and promoting a clean, organized environment.
